sub函数是C语言中的一个内置函数,用于计算两个数的差值。其函数原型为: int sub(int a, int b); 其中a和b为待计算的两个数,函数返回值为它们的差值。 使用sub函数的方式为在程序中调用该函数并将需要计算的两个数作为参数传入,如下所示: int result = sub(10, 5); 上述代码将计算10和5的差值,并将结...
sub函数是其中一种常见的函数类型,它用于实现字符串或字符的替换操作。在本文中,我们将详细介绍C语言中sub函数的用法和实现原理。 sub函数的基本用法 sub函数用于替换字符串或字符中的指定内容。它通常具有以下的语法结构: char*sub(char*str,char*old,char*new); 其中,str是待替换的字符串或字符,old是需要被...
在C语言中,sub函数的用法是用于从字符串中删除指定的子字符串。 函数声明:char *sub(char *str, const char *substr) 参数: str:指向原始字符串的指针 substr:指向要删除的子字符串的指针 返回值:返回删除子字符串后的新字符串 示例代码: #include <stdio.h> #include <string.h> char *sub(char *str,...
以下是一些sub函数的用法示例:替换字符串中的指定字符: void sub(char* str, char oldChar, char newChar) { for (int i = 0; str[i] != '\0'; i++) { if (str[i] == oldChar) { str[i] = newChar; } } } 复制代码截取字符串的子串: voidsub(char* dest, const char* src, int s...
在C语言中,sub是一个操作符,表示减法运算。它的作用是将两个数相减,返回它们的差。例如,表达式 x - y 表示将y从x中减去,结果为x和y的差。sub也可以被看作一种函数,它会接收两个参数,分别是要相减的两个数,然后返回它们的差。在C语言中,sub常用于数学计算和变量赋值等场景。除了代表...
void sub(int x,int y,int *z)/*不需要返回值,加viod*/ {*z=y-x;} /*主函数(调用函数)*/ main(){ int a,b,c;sub(10,5,&a);/*&a本身没有值,在被调用函数sub中被赋值*/ sub(7,a,&b);/*&b本身没有值,在被调用函数sub中被赋值*/ sub(a,b,&c);/*&c本身没有值,在被调用...
/*&b本身没有值,在被调用函数sub中被赋值*/ sub(a,b,&c); /*&c本身没有值,在被调用函数sub中被赋值*/ printf("%d,%d,%d\n",a,b,c); ~ ②计算过程 实参赋值形参 x=10,y=5,*z=&a 用形参公式计算 *z=y-x=5-10=-5 即a=-5 ...
在C语言中,sub并不是一个关键字或函数名,你可能指的是减法操作符或者子程序(也称为函数),下面我将分别介绍这两种情况的用法。 (图片来源网络,侵删) 1. 减法操作符 在C语言中,减法操作符用于执行两个数之间的减法运算,它有两种形式:一元减法和二元减法。
在C语言中,sub是一个简写形式,表示的是subtract(减法)。当我们使用sub时,意味着我们正在进行从一个数值中减去另一个数值的操作。在编程中,通过sub可以实现减法运算,适用于算术表达式和函数中的减法操作。C语言中的sub是十分常用的关键字,能够帮助程序员轻松地进行减法运算,同时也是C语言中重要的...
在C语言中,sub常常用来表示一个函数或操作的子集。通常情况下,我们在定义一个函数时,会将函数中具体的操作和过程分解为多个子函数或子操作,这些子操作就可以理解为sub。sub和其他关键字的区别?C语言中有很多关键字,比如说int, float, if, else等,这些关键字都有自己特定的含义和用法。sub和这些...